Conventions for the List

  • As set down in Kingdom Law, the List shall be double elimination, with the first round pairings to be chosen at random.
  • For the initial Rounds, before the semi-finals, Matches will be best two-out-three. After which, Rounds will proceed in traditional fashion.
  • Individual bouts, save as stipulated for the Finals, need not be of matched weapons.
  • The finals shall be best two-out-of-three. The first two bouts will be matched styles, the higher-ranking combatant having first choice of weapons.
  • The third bout (if necessary) with whatever weapons suit the individual combatants.

Expectations of Combatants

  • A combatant's harness and weapons must be in good repair, and their appearance befitting the august venue of a Crown Tournament.
  • No obvious duct tape should be evident in a combatants harness, save on their weapons and as emergency repairs during the course of the Tournament.
  • Obviously modern sporting equipment, including but not limited to hockey gloves and footwear, should be covered or otherwise camouflaged.

Rules for the combats

  • Thrusting to the face will not be allowed.
  • Pole-weapons will be no longer than 6 feet.
  • Single-handed weapons will be no longer than 42 inches from pommel to tip.
  • Strapped heater-shaped shields may be no larger than 32” top to bottom.
  • Center-grip shields may be no more than 30” in any dimension.
  • Save for the above restrictions, any SCA legal weapons form may be used.
